2005-2006: The Year in Review
Enrollment:  160 Band Students (Band and Color Guard)

Major Event for 2005-2006:
The Hawk Band was one of only eight bands nationwide to be selected to march in the 86th Annual 6ABC/Boscov’s Thanksgiving Day Parade in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ania on November 24th, 2005.
